摘要
Enantiopure acylphosphites have been prepared based upon chiral nonsubstituted and 3,3'-disubstituted binaphthols in order to elucidate steric and electronic effects on the Rh(I)-catalyzed asymmetric hydrogenation of functionalized olefins. With these new types of ligands, up to 80% ee was obtained. Rate as well as enantio selectivity of the hydrogenation were strongly dependent on the precatalyst preparation and substitution pattern of the ligand. (C) 2004 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
